Bug 1514594: Part 3a - Change ChromeUtils.import to return an exports object; not pollute global. r=mccr8

This changes the behavior of ChromeUtils.import() to return an exports object,
rather than a module global, in all cases except when `null` is passed as a
second argument, and changes the default behavior not to pollute the global
scope with the module's exports. Thus, the following code written for the old
model:

  ChromeUtils.import("resource://gre/modules/Services.jsm");

is approximately the same as the following, in the new model:

  var {Services} = ChromeUtils.import("resource://gre/modules/Services.jsm");

Since the two behaviors are mutually incompatible, this patch will land with a
scripted rewrite to update all existing callers to use the new model rather
than the old.

/* -*- Mode: indent-tabs-mode: nil; js-indent-level: 2 -*- */
/* vim: set sts=2 sw=2 et tw=80: */
"use strict";
/* exported registerContentScript, unregisterContentScript */
/* global registerContentScript, unregisterContentScript */
var {ExtensionUtils} = ChromeUtils.import("resource://gre/modules/ExtensionUtils.jsm");
var {
ExtensionError,
getUniqueId,
} = ExtensionUtils;
/**
* Represents (in the main browser process) a content script registered
* programmatically (instead of being included in the addon manifest).
*
* @param {ProxyContextParent} context
* The parent proxy context related to the extension context which
* has registered the content script.
* @param {RegisteredContentScriptOptions} details
* The options object related to the registered content script
* (which has the properties described in the content_scripts.json
* JSON API schema file).
*/
class ContentScriptParent {
constructor({context, details}) {
this.context = context;
this.scriptId = getUniqueId();
this.blobURLs = new Set();
this.options = this._convertOptions(details);
context.callOnClose(this);
}
close() {
this.destroy();
}
destroy() {
if (this.destroyed) {
throw new Error("Unable to destroy ContentScriptParent twice");
}
this.destroyed = true;
this.context.forgetOnClose(this);
for (const blobURL of this.blobURLs) {
this.context.cloneScope.URL.revokeObjectURL(blobURL);
}
this.blobURLs.clear();
this.context = null;
this.options = null;
}
_convertOptions(details) {
const {context} = this;
const options = {
matches: details.matches,
excludeMatches: details.excludeMatches,
includeGlobs: details.includeGlobs,
excludeGlobs: details.excludeGlobs,
allFrames: details.allFrames,
matchAboutBlank: details.matchAboutBlank,
runAt: details.runAt || "document_idle",
jsPaths: [],
cssPaths: [],
};
const convertCodeToURL = (data, mime) => {
const blob = new context.cloneScope.Blob(data, {type: mime});
const blobURL = context.cloneScope.URL.createObjectURL(blob);
this.blobURLs.add(blobURL);
return blobURL;
};
if (details.js && details.js.length > 0) {
options.jsPaths = details.js.map(data => {
if (data.file) {
return data.file;
}
return convertCodeToURL([data.code], "text/javascript");
});
}
if (details.css && details.css.length > 0) {
options.cssPaths = details.css.map(data => {
if (data.file) {
return data.file;
}
return convertCodeToURL([data.code], "text/css");
});
}
return options;
}
serialize() {
return this.options;
}
}
this.contentScripts = class extends ExtensionAPI {
getAPI(context) {
const {extension} = context;
// Map of the content script registered from the extension context.
//
// Map<scriptId -> ContentScriptParent>
const parentScriptsMap = new Map();
// Unregister all the scriptId related to a context when it is closed.
context.callOnClose({
close() {
if (parentScriptsMap.size === 0) {
return;
}
const scriptIds = Array.from(parentScriptsMap.keys());
for (let scriptId of scriptIds) {
extension.registeredContentScripts.delete(scriptId);
}
extension.updateContentScripts();
extension.broadcast("Extension:UnregisterContentScripts", {
id: extension.id,
scriptIds,
});
},
});
return {
contentScripts: {
async register(details) {
for (let origin of details.matches) {
if (!extension.whiteListedHosts.subsumes(new MatchPattern(origin))) {
throw new ExtensionError(`Permission denied to register a content script for ${origin}`);
}
}
const contentScript = new ContentScriptParent({context, details});
const {scriptId} = contentScript;
parentScriptsMap.set(scriptId, contentScript);
const scriptOptions = contentScript.serialize();
await extension.broadcast("Extension:RegisterContentScript", {
id: extension.id,
options: scriptOptions,
scriptId,
});
extension.registeredContentScripts.set(scriptId, scriptOptions);
extension.updateContentScripts();
return scriptId;
},
// This method is not available to the extension code, the extension code
// doesn't have access to the internally used scriptId, on the contrary
// the extension code will call script.unregister on the script API object
// that is resolved from the register API method returned promise.
async unregister(scriptId) {
const contentScript = parentScriptsMap.get(scriptId);
if (!contentScript) {
Cu.reportError(new Error(`No such content script ID: ${scriptId}`));
return;
}
parentScriptsMap.delete(scriptId);
extension.registeredContentScripts.delete(scriptId);
extension.updateContentScripts();
contentScript.destroy();
await extension.broadcast("Extension:UnregisterContentScripts", {
id: extension.id,
scriptIds: [scriptId],
});
},
},
};
}
};
